5 Places In Texas To Get You In The Christmas Spirit
Austin Trail of Lights

With December around the corner (finally!!), everyone's switching into full on Christmas mode. That means all of the best Christmas movies, music, and destinations are coming back. Here are some of my personal favorite places around Texas that get you into the Christmas spirit if you aren't already!

1. Santa's Wonderland - College Station, Texas

November 10 - January 7

What better way to celebrate Christmas than under beautiful lights in College Station! Santa's Wonderland offers hayrides, carriage rides, live music, and even meet and greets with Santa himself. Perfect for people of all ages, this is one stop that tops them all!

2. ICE! at Gaylord Texan - Grapevine, Texas

November 10 - January 1

This year, walk through the stop "'Twas the Night Before Christmas" recreated in 2 million pounds if ice. All in chilly 9°F, the Gaylord offers a fun twist on this classic Christmas story. Great for families and large groups, the Gaylord Texan offers something for anyone.


3. Dallas Arboretum 12 Day of Christmas at Night - Dallas, Texas

November 4 - January 7

See the Dallas Botanical Gardens in holiday splendor by walking through the gardens illuminated at night. You won't want to miss the eye catching display of enclosed gazebos with the 12 Days of Christmas recreated inside.


4. Zoo Lights - Houston, Texas

November 18 - January 14

Enjoy the Houston Zoo at night and lit up in Christmas lights. Explore the exhibits with your family and enjoy Christmas at the Zoo.


5. Austin Trail of Lights - Austin, Texas

December 9 - 23, 2017

Visit Austin’s largest holiday tradition and 2nd largest event in the city and celebrate Christmas at the same time. This event brings together the Austin community while celebrating Christmas with your family
